Biography

Dr. Gilberto Silva Nunes Bezerra joined the Department of Life & Health Sciences at DkIT in 2025. A pharmacist by training with a PhD in Polymer Engineering focused on Pharmaceutical Manufacturing, his work sits at the intersection of microbiology and advanced drug delivery systems.

Gilberto currently lectures on several specialized modules, where he integrates his academic research background with practical industry insights gained during his time as a Science Graduate at Boston Scientific. His research profile includes over 30 peer-reviewed publications and a strong history of international collaboration.
